Location

The property is located within a prominent position on Mill Street, close to the town centre of Bedworth. The town features a blend of traditional and modern amenities, with a central area that includes independent shops, cafes, and a bustling market.

With two popular bus stops directly outside the property and three Supermarkets in close proximity (Iceland - 20m, Tesco Extra - 50m and Aldi - 150m), the property experiences high levels of daily foot traffic from both Mill Street and Sleaths Yard (the main access to the Tesco Extra).

Bedworth is located in the county of Warwickshire, in the West Midlands region of England. It lies approximately 3 miles (5 kilometers) south of the larger town of Nuneaton and about 5 miles (8 kilometers) north of Coventry.

The town is well-positioned near major transportation routes, including the M6 motorway to the west, which provides convenient access to nearby cities like Birmingham and Leicester, and the A444, which connects Bedworth to Nuneaton and Coventry. The town is also served by Bedworth railway station, which provides links to regional rail networks.
